RSA Endowment

In terminal decline (compensation already recieved a few years ago), given current market would it be best to tough it out or surrender and use the money to repay capital from the YBS capital and interest mortgage that we switched to in 2004?

  • Thanks for the reply, new to this - additional info

    Sum Assured £65,000
    Current surrender value £15,000
    Monthly Premium £90
    Start date 03/1992
    Maturity date 03/2017
    Maturity forecast 4% -£28,000/6% -£32,200/8% - £37,000
    Current Mortgage with YBS, £30,000 fixed at 5.75% until May 09 then .75% above base.

    Any suggestions of best course of action greatly appreciated
  • EdInvestor
    EdInvestor Posts: 15,749 Forumite
    onojoko wrote: »
    Maturity forecast 4% -£28,000/6% -£32,200/8% - £37,000

    If you surrendered this policy and used the lump sum to reduce the mortgage, also increasing the mortgage payment by the redundant premium amount, your return at maturity would be 34,381. This is much better than the likely return of the endowment (4% if you're lucky) and has no risk. So I would bin the endowment and proceed as above forthwith.
